Detection of Metastases of Primary Hepatocellular Carcinoma with $^{99m}Tc-HIDA$ Scintigraphy ($^{99m}Tc-HIDA$를 이용(利用)한 원발성간세포암전이(原發性肝細胞癌轉移) 병소(病巢)의 진단(診斷))

  • $^{99m}Tc-Sulfur$ Colloid is concentrated in Kupffer cells of the liver, whereas the new biliary agents such as $^{99m}Tc-HIDA$ are processed by hepatic parenchymal cells. The distant metastatic lesiors in skull and lung of the primary hepatocellular carcinoma in 38-year old Korean male were detected with $^{99m}Tc-HIDA$ scintigraphy. The chest PA, skull bone X-ray and radionuclide scintigraphic studies are illustrated. This observation suggests that $^{99m}Tc-HIDA$ scintigraphy is useful for detection of distant metastases of primary hepatocellular carcinoma.

Myxoid Liposarcoma: A Single Institute Experience (점액성 지방육종: 단일기관 치료 결과)

  • Purpose: This study assessed the treatment outcomes of myxoid liposarcoma in the extremities and investigate the prognostic factors. Materials and Methods: A total of 91 patients with myxoid liposarcoma (83 primary, 8 recurrent) between 2001 and 2015 were reviewed retrospectively. The local recurrence and metastasis after treatment were examined. The survival rates and prognostic factors affecting the survival were investigated. The mean follow-up was 84 months (range, 5-196 months). Results: The overall survival rates at 5-yr and 10-yr were 82% and 74%, respectively. The tumor size (p=0.04), round cell component (p<0.0001), grade (p=0.0002), and local recurrence (p=0.006) affected survival in primary patients. Extrapulmonary metastases were observed in 75.0% (18/24) of metastatic patients and the mean post metastasis survival was 26 months (range, 2-72 months) Conclusion: Myxoid liposarcoma developed mainly at the lower extremities. The tumor size, grade, component of round cells, and local recurrence were associated with the prognosis. The unique feature of extrapulmonary metastasis in myxoid liposarcoma should be noted in the treatment and follow-up.

Imaging Findings of a Malignant Rhabdoid Tumor in the Stomach: A Case Report (위에 발생한 악성 횡문근양 종양의 영상 소견: 증례 보고)

  • A malignant rhabdoid tumor is an aggressive tumor that occurs mainly in the kidney of infants and children. When it occurs in extrarenal sites, it is referred to as an extrarenal malignant rhabdoid tumor. Although a few cases of malignant rhabdoid tumor occuring in the central nervous system, liver, brain, skin, and soft tissue have been reported, it is rarely observed in the stomach. We report the imaging findings of a malignant rhabdoid tumor of the stomach that mimicked a gastric lymphoma in a patient who presented with melena.

Isolated Small Bowel Metastasis of Endometrial Carcinoma with Resultant Jejunojejunal Intussusception: A Case Report (자궁내막암의 단독 소장 전이로 인해 유발된 공장-공장 장중첩증: 증례 보고)

  • Endometrial carcinoma is a common gynecologic malignancy; however, metastasis to the small bowel is rare. Metastatic endometrial carcinoma usually occurs through local extension rather than distant metastasis. Isolated small bowel metastasis is extremely rare; further, intussusception with resultant intestinal obstruction is not common. We report the imaging findings of a patient with isolated small bowel metastasis of endometrial carcinoma with resultant jejunojejunal intussusception.

Osteosarcomatous Transformation in Mazabraud Syndrome: A Case Report (Mazabraud 증후군에서 발생한 골육종으로 악성 변환: 증례 보고)

  • Mazabraud syndrome is a rare benign disease that is accompanied by polyostotic fibrous dysplasia and intramuscular myxoma. Malignant transformation of fibrous dysplasia occurs in approximately 1% of cases. To date, only eight cases of malignant transformation, of fibrous dysplasia to osteosarcoma, in Mazabraud syndrome have been reported worldwide. The authors report the first case of osteosarcomatous transformation in a patient with Mazabraud syndrome in the Republic of Korea, focusing on imaging findings.

Superior Mesenteric Venous Thrombophlebitis with Terminal Ileal Diverticulitis: A Case Report (말단 회장의 게실염에 동반된 혈전정맥염: 증례 보고)

  • Mesenteric venous thrombophlebitis secondary to inflammatory processes such as diverticulitis and appendicitis is a rare disease; however, it can nonetheless cause bowel ischemia and infarctions. Radiologic diagnosis is vital for mesenteric venous thrombophlebitis complicated with diverticulitis due to its non-specific clinical presentation and very low incidence. We report a case of a 61-year-old woman with superior mesenteric vein thrombosis and ileocecal diverticulitis on CT, which was resolved after treatment with a combination of antibiotic therapy and right hemicolectomy.
